[2013] UKPC 8

The appellant's conviction for murder was not rendered unsafe by fresh evidence in the form of a statement by a witness which cast doubt on the assertion of the one eyewitness relied on by the prosecution that he had been present at the scene of the murder.

PC (Jam) (Lord Hope, Lord Kerr, Lord Reed, Lord Carnwath, Sir John Chadwick)
